Web Design Weekly #191

June 22, 2015 - Jake Bresnehan

Headlines

What is Code?

This article by Paul Ford is epic. If you haven’t had time, or it is on your ‘read later’ list, now is the time to brew up a big coffee and enjoy it. (bloomberg.com)

You know how to code, but how are your UI/UX design skills?

Do you ever wish your websites & apps looked more “professional”? Take one of our online UI/UX design courses with hands-on projects & 1-on-1 mentoring from expert designers — we guarantee you’ll see an improvement in your work. Sign up today! (trydesignlab.com)

Articles

Modern Design Tools: Using Real Data

Josh Puckett floats the idea of a design tool that easily integrates with real data so we can focus on solving product and interaction problems as well as visual ones. (medium.com)

Progressive Apps: Escaping Tabs Without Losing Our Soul

A great post by Alex Russell about “Progressive Apps”. No doubt we will be seeing many more articles digging into this in the not to distant future. (infrequently.org)

Techniques for writing semantic and maintainable JavaScript

Nick Wientge explores 3 simple techniques that can be applied to your JavaScript app today. (medium.com)

The Future Generation of CSS Selectors: Level 4 (sitepoint.com)

Importing CSS Breakpoints Into Javascript (lullabot.com)

Tools / Resources

A Practical Guide to SVGs on the web

This guide by Jake Giltsoff gives a practical overview of how you can use SVGs on your websites. If you are an SVG beginner or expert it is a great read. (svgontheweb.com)

Envato Market have just released their ‘Structure Styleguide’

A Structure Styleguide is a special breed of living styleguide, designed to document an application’s UI logic and all of the possible permutations of the UI. In this post Jordan Lewis gives you the lowdown on the finer details. (webuild.envato.com)

PurifyCSS

Detects which CSS classes your app is using and creates a file without the unused CSS. PurifyCSS has been designed from the beginning with single-page apps in mind. (github.com)

Dynamics.js

Javascript library to create physics-based CSS animations. (dynamicsjs.com)

Gradify

A handy module to produce CSS gradients as placeholders for images. (gradifycss.com)

Exploring ES6 (leanpub.com)

Conical gradients, today (lea.verou.me)

Inspiration

Creative Gooey Effects

A set of examples that use a gooey SVG filter for creating a variety of different effects for all kinds of website components. (tympanus.net)

Great tips for building a great design portfolio (medium.com)

Things I’ve Learned About CSS (youtube.com)

Jobs

Software Engineer, Frontend at Airbnb

Frontend Engineers are an essential part of Airbnb’s Product Team. Working closely with designers, we implement the user interface of our web app. If this sounds like fun, then why not apply? (airbnb.com)

Need to find passionate developers? Why not advertise in the next newsletter!

From The Blog

Basic Performant Sharing Buttons

This is a lightweight, simple solution for adding sharing buttons to your site. Like many things, there are many ways to achieve this but the main goal of this solution is performance. (web-design-weekly.com)

Last but not least…

On being overwhelmed with our fast paced industry (wesbos.com)

Understanding npm (nodesource.com)